9 Physical and chemical properties:


General Information



Form: Lump



Color: White
Odor: Odorless



Value/Range Unit
Method



Change in condition



Melting point/Melting range: 1520 掳 C



Boiling point/Boiling range: Not determined



Sublimation temperature / start: Not determined



Flash point: Not applicable



Ignition temperature: Not determined



Decomposition temperature: Not determined



Danger of explosion:


Product does not present an explosion hazard.

Explosion limits:
Lower: Not determined



Upper: Not determined



Vapor pressure: Not determined



Density: at 20 掳 C 4.47 g/cm鲁



Solubility in / Miscibility with



Water: Insoluble

11 Toxicological information
Acute toxicity:


LD/LC50 values that are relevant for classification:

Oral: LD: >10 gm/kg (rat)
LD50: >4000 mg/kg (mus)

Primary irritant effect:



on the skin: Irritant to skin and mucous membranes.



on the eye: Irritating effect.



Sensitization: No sensitizing effects known.



Subacute to chronic toxicity:


Niobium compounds have caused liver damage in animal
studies. Niobium metal has caused kidney damage in
experimental animals and fibrogenic effects on the lungs of
experimental animals.

Subacute to chronic toxicity:


The Registry of Toxic Effects of Chemical Substances
(RTECS) reports the following effects in laboratory
animals:
Behavioral - muscle contraction or spasticity.
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- acute pulmonary edema.
Liver - hepatitis (hepatocellular necrosis), difuse
Cardiac - other changes.
Blood - other changes.
Additional toxicological information:


To the best of our knowledge the acute and chronic toxicity
of this substance is not fully known.
No classification data on carcinogenic properties of this
material is available from the EPA, IARC, NTP, OSHA or
ACGIH.
